Connected Biosensors - Ireland

  • Ireland
  • The market segment of Connected Biosensors in Ireland is projected to reach a revenue of US$15.15m in 2024.
  • It is expected to exhibit an annual growth rate (CAGR 2024-2028) of 3.61%, resulting in a projected market volume of US$17.46m by 2028.
  • User penetration is anticipated to be 3.83% in 2024 and is expected to increase to 3.94% by 2028.
  • The average revenue per user (ARPU) is projected to be US$77.89.
  • In a global comparison, in China is expected to generate the highest revenue with US$4,493.00m in 2024.

Analyst Opinion

The Connected Biosensors market in Ireland is experiencing a significant growth trajectory driven by various factors unique to the region.

Customer preferences:
Irish consumers are increasingly leaning towards connected biosensors due to the convenience and efficiency they offer in monitoring health parameters. The shift towards proactive health management and the growing awareness of the benefits of early detection are driving the demand for smart thermometers, blood glucose meters, blood pressure meters, and social alarms in Ireland.

Trends in the market:
One notable trend in the Connected Biosensors market in Ireland is the integration of advanced technologies such as IoT and AI to enhance the functionality and accuracy of these devices. Manufacturers are focusing on developing user-friendly interfaces and seamless connectivity to smartphones or other devices, catering to the tech-savvy Irish population. Additionally, there is a rising trend of personalized healthcare solutions, where connected biosensors provide real-time data and insights tailored to individual users' needs.

Local special circumstances:
Ireland's healthcare system is undergoing digital transformation, with an emphasis on remote monitoring and telehealth solutions. The government's initiatives to promote digital health technologies and the increasing collaborations between healthcare providers and technology companies are creating a conducive environment for the adoption of connected biosensors in the country. Moreover, the presence of a strong pharmaceutical and medical device industry in Ireland is fostering innovation and driving the development of advanced biosensor technologies.

Underlying macroeconomic factors:
The overall economic stability and increasing disposable income levels in Ireland are supporting the growth of the Connected Biosensors market. As consumers prioritize health and wellness, they are willing to invest in connected biosensors to monitor their health proactively. Furthermore, the aging population in Ireland is fueling the demand for healthcare solutions that enable remote monitoring and management of chronic conditions, driving the adoption of smart biosensors in the country.

Methodology

Data coverage:

The data encompasses B2C enterprises. Figures are based on revenues and user data of relevant mobile applications and consumer electronics companies.

Modeling approach / Market size:

Market sizes are determined through a combined top-down and bottom-up approach, building on a specific rationale for each market segment. As a basis for evaluating markets, we use annual financial reports of key players, industry reports, third-party reports, and survey results from primary research (e.g., the Statista Global Consumer Survey). In addition, we use relevant key market indicators and data from country-specific associations, such as GDP, population, internet penetration, smartphone penetration, consumer spending, and healthcare spending. This data helps us estimate the market size for each country individually.

Forecasts:

In our forecasts, we apply diverse forecasting techniques. The selection of forecasting techniques is based on the behavior of the relevant market. For example, the S-curve function and exponential trend smoothing are well suited for forecasting digital products and services due to the non-linear growth of technology adoption.

Additional notes:

The market is updated twice a year in case market dynamics change. The impact of the COVID-19 pandemic and the Russia-Ukraine war is considered at a country-specific level.
